Output 8aeb1e11251f486095c33021b958c3556f73f471973ef69a103696d58f362af6:52

value
2521856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d7b81bf03b1dc8c8f67c98c181d0d23930cebfa OP_EQUAL
address
3QoJqUs39Ji6naGNyySdsFyWrnKkE2XM1c
transaction
8aeb1e11251f486095c33021b958c3556f73f471973ef69a103696d58f362af6
spent
true